3.5 SFR turbo, SFR IM, NWP spacer, and cutout
I will post dyno, hopefully tomorrow.
First I had the car dynoed right before everything was installed.
whp 381.4
torque 387.9
Then installed the IM from Speed Force Racing, spacer kit from NWP, and the electronic cutout from DMH Performance. Results
whp 407.6
cant remember the torque but will post tomorrow.
The charts are pretty impressive. It doesnt really fall off anymore like it did before.

I30T BBS 15" rims will clear the front brakes of a 5.5 gen (Stock only obviously), I'm sure there are others as well but it's definitely limited as there is only about 1/16" of clearance between the caliper with the I30t wheels, in fact it was so little that sometimes when snow got packed in them and then froze overnight the next morning you could feel/hear it tweaking the caliper sideways for the first minute of driving.
